Tomahawk lost to Spencer back in December of 2024 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Hatchets lost 56-36 to the Rockets. While losing is never fun, the Hatchets can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Wisconsin basketball rankings (they are ranked 411th, while the Rockets are ranked 57th).
Tomahawk's loss was their 11th straight on the road d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 1-7. As for Spencer, the victory keeps them at an undefeated 10-0.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Tomahawk will face off against Rhinelander on Tuesday. The Hatchets will need to watch out since the Hodags have now posted at least 55 points in their last three games. As for Spencer, they will challenge Abbotsford at 3:00 p.m. on Friday. The Rockets will be up against the Falcons' rather soft defense (which has allowed 70.13 points per matchup),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ance.
